Lower Urinary Tract Symptoms Clinical Trial
Official title:
Filling and Emptying Cystometries: a Feasibility and Validation Study in Order to Simplify the Manometric Follow-up of Overactive Detrusor in Neurological Patients Under Anticholinergic or Botulinum Toxin Injections.

This study evaluate the feasibility and the accuracy of an emptying cystometry in order to simplify the manometric follow-up of overactive detrusor in neurological patients under anticholinergic or botulinum toxin injections.
